| Review: |
Well when i bought this gun i already had a Mr1 but wanted something with a little more "power", so i looked around and bought a E-Mr1. It is a amazing gun for the price, its accurate, lightweight, loud ( i dont know why people complain about how loud it is its just intimidating). I would buy a Compressed air when you get this marker if not your going to be making snow cones on full auto. The E-Mr1 keeps up with and passes A-5's, it can hold its own against most other markers. You also dont need to spend 100's on a hopper, you only need to find one that can go faster than 15bps which i got mine for 30 bucks. |
 |
| Conclusion: |
Although this is not a great beginer gun ( i would recomend a Mr1 semi auto mechanical first ) i would stick to the mechanical one to learn about spyders first and then move up to electro. |
